WebPenned by Aphra Behn, the first Englishwoman known to have earned a living through her writing, Oroonoko; or, The Royal Slave was published in 1688, at which time, in the … WebPenned by Aphra Behn, the first Englishwoman known to have earned a living through her writing, Oroonoko; or, The Royal Slave was published in 1688, at which time, in the nascent years of abolitionism, it was viewed as a progressive antislavery text. Web17 sep. 2007 · 8 Ammar ibn Yasir570–657. Ammar bin Yasir is one of the most famous companions of Muhammad and was among the slaves freed by Abu Bakr. Shi’a Muslims venerate him as one of the Four Companions, early Muslims who were Ali ibn Abi Talib followers. Ammar was born in the Year of the Elephant.
